Illegear Unveils Seaview, Revive, Reaper, Aethra

Illegear Seaview, Revive, Reaper, and Aethra Custom PC Builds
Illegear, a Malaysian custom PC manufacturer, introduced four new desktop builds in 2026: the Seaview, Revive, Reaper, and Aethra. These systems target gamers, content creators, and professionals seeking pre-configured, high-performance computing solutions. The builds are designed to offer specific aesthetic and performance profiles, ranging from panoramic glass chassis to compact form factors.
